Dependency Ratios for US ZIP Code 97477

Total Dependency Ratio:
61.0
Youth Dependency:
31.4
Old-Age Dependency:
29.6

The dependency ratio measures dependents (ages 0-17 and 65+) per 100 working-age individuals (ages 18-64).
